Experience Rome: Exclusive Wine Tasting in the City Center!
Imagine strolling through Rome’s historic streets, then stepping into a refined wine tasting that highlights Italy’s best and some international favorites. For just over $40 per person, you get a one-hour intimate experience with five exceptional wines, guided by friendly and knowledgeable staff. From the moment you arrive, you’re greeted with a welcoming ambiance that combines traditional elegance with a modern flair, perfect for those who want a taste of Roman sophistication without the crowds.
What draws many to this experience is the opportunity to explore diverse local and international wines in one sitting, all within a cozy, small-group setting of no more than ten guests. Two features we especially appreciated are the insightful guidance that helps you understand the wine’s story and the chance to enjoy high-quality selections you might not easily find elsewhere. The only consideration? With only an hour, it’s a quick stop, so if you’re a dedicated wine enthusiast, you might wish for a longer, more in-depth tasting.
This tour is especially suited for travelers who enjoy discovering new flavors and want a relaxed, educational experience in the heart of Rome. It works well if you’re looking for an authentic, intimate activity that combines culture, taste, and a bit of Roman flair.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this wine tasting suitable for minors?
No, minors, pregnant women, and children under 18 are not allowed to participate in this activity.
How long does the tasting last?
The experience lasts approximately one hour, with specific start times available depending on your reservation.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, making it flexible for your travel plans.
Is the tour accessible for people in wheelchairs?
Yes, the venue is wheelchair accessible, ensuring that most guests can enjoy the experience comfortably.
What languages are the guides available in?
The guides speak Italian and English, making it easy to follow along and ask questions.
How many people can join this tour?
The experience is designed for a small group of up to 10 participants, ensuring a more personalized experience.
